For MAC and PC: Click on the appropriate link for the template you wish to download. Save the file to your computer in the following location: > Applications > Microsoft Office > Templates > My Templates

Using the templates
Launch PowerPoint and select "Project Gallery" from the "File" menu. To create a new presentation the previously saved KU template, choose "My templates" under the "New" tab. All templates saved in your "My templates" folder will appear here. To add new slide types, click "Add Objects" from the "Formatting Palette." The template design will be applied to the slide type you choose.

Customizing the template
Users can customize KU templates by replacing the university signature with the signature of their parent unit.
From the "View" menu, select "Master," then "Title Master." The signature on the title page may be replaced by a unit signature. From the "Insert" menu, select "Picture," then "From file" to locate your unit signature file. Be sure to save your unit signature as a GIF or PNG file before inserting it. Once inserted, size your signature accordingly by dragging the corners or by using the tools in the "Image" section of the formatting palette. Delete the university signature. To customize the interior slides in your presentation, simply repeat the process by selecting "Master," then "Slide Master" from the "View" menu.

Adding KU photos
Adding KU photos to your presentation has been made more convenient. Visit www.photos.ku.edu to view hundreds of KU photographs taken by University Relations photographers. You can view them by category or search for an image by keyword. Once you’ve identified an image, click it to open a high resolution version that can be downloaded free of charge. Simply right click (for PC users) to download to your hard disk, or drag and drop (for MAC users). Then in PowerPoint, from the "Insert" menu, select "Picture," then FROM FILE, to add the downloaded image. Please credit all photos with “KU University Relations.”
Adding KU audio
To add KU audio to a PowerPoint presentation, visit the Communicator Audio Resources page. Once you find the audio file(s) that you would like to use in your PowerPoint, save the file(s) to your computer by right clicking on the audio link and choosing "Save link as" or "Save target as." In PowerPoint, click the "Insert" menu, select "Movies and sounds," then select "Sound from File." Navigate to your sound file, select it, and click the "Insert" button. An audio file icon will be placed in you document. You can fine tune the playing of the file by right clicking on the audio file icon that is inserted.
